Then, holding these things again, she went to those servant women, the coarse-footed wives. These wives from ordinary families appeared a bit uneasy; the maid threw down these things and lifted her sleeve to cover her nose, seemingly unhappy with the smell here.

This caused those coarse-handed wives to become even more nervous and uneasy.

The maid briefly instructed the matters and then left.

Another night, the servants of the Right Minister’s Mansion gathered there. The man who should have received his own land deeds and indentures was holding ten Copper Coins, seemingly with a sense of unbelievable, unexpected delight.

The Right Minister is benevolent, giving money!

The wives brought back some colorful cloth, saying it was for embroidering words. This was not a difficult task; previous tasks were much harder than this, but after all, today they got ten coins.

The man saved five coins, planning to send them back next year to redeem his land for a good life.

The remaining five coins were used to buy two pancakes, some vegetables, and a bit of meat edges, happily returning home.

Intending to let the wife, who suffered alongside him, eat something good.

Such good things!

There’s meat, vegetables, and soft pancakes.

But when leaving the side courtyard gate to head home, he encountered some well-dressed genuine house servants of the Right Minister’s Mansion, and the man’s heart sank.

The Right Minister is a distinguished gentleman, though maintaining a gentleman’s lifestyle and grandeur, with a mansion, but very frugal. There are only about twenty servants in the mansion, recognized by the world for his virtues, known for simplicity.

However, below these house servants, there were plenty of mud-legged ones who had no status, fame, did not need a good treatment. Despite debts, selling themselves, needing not to be fed nor housed, even if sick or dead, it had nothing to do with the master.

Monthly they receive just a little money.

These house servants were also masters.

One of them lifted his eyes and smiled.

The man saw the bulging pouch full of Copper Coins at the house servant’s waist.

The servant laughed and cursed: "Heard you have gotten rich today, share seventy percent, how about it?"

The man stammered: "Me, ten coins, I’ve spent it all..."

Eyebrows raised, the servant cursed: "Ten coins, you poor wretches, how could you dare spend on yourself? Here you are, fooling with your father, begging for a beating!" Then he gave him a good beating, leaving him bruised, staggering back with his belongings.

The money was snatched away, and only some pancakes remained, dropped on the ground only for the servant to stomp them to pieces, it was heart-wrenching to see. Yet, reluctant to waste, crouching down for a long time, he scraped it up, held it in hand, and went back.

The house servants broke out in a burst of laughter.

The food scrambled by a dog.

The man smiled apologetically, knelt, kowtowed, barked severally like a dog.

The house servants clapped and laughed: "Good dog, good dog!"

From the distant rockery, in the pavilion and water pavilion, the young ladies frowned, the upper maids laughed: "So disgraceful, teasing those people again."

Although they owe our Prime Minister so much debt, it’s not excessive.

Those young ladies were truly like flowers and the moon, clean like white snow.

Each of their top maids were outstanding persons.

The maids below were diligent and reliable, house servants kind and obedient, truly a peaceful day, but today the wind and snow were a bit strong, causing the petals of the flowers liked by the ladies to fall, which was unpleasant.

The man returned with the ruined pancakes.

The couple looked at the pancakes mixed with dirt, the wife asked: "Where is the money?"

The man’s lips trembled, saying nothing.

The woman understood everything, said nothing, merely patted the dirt off the pancakes, then placed them in the pot, stirred with water, without using wood, firewood comes from the mountains, and the mountains belong to the families, thus firewood costs money.

Stirring with water, mixing up, eventually becoming a sloppy mush.

That coarse-handed wife took a bite, cheerfully said: "Delicious."

"It tastes like meat!"

Passed the chipped bowl to the man: "You eat too."

The man took a bite, feeling a little sour in the nose, eyes turned red. He thought he was very hardworking, diligent, yet why life wasn’t getting better, under the moonlight, the woman widened her eyes to embroider the colorful cloth.

There were many demands, she found a rosy fabric, rubbed her palm over it, even brushed it against her cheek.

Such a good cloth, if only a little could be kept, it could be used to make some new clothes for the children at home, but she dared not, as someone had done so before, beaten to death.

Because that was stealing the owner’s money.

But where did the owner’s money come from?

She didn’t know, just kept embroidering on the cloth, on the rosy colorful cloth, embroidered cloud pattern, qilin pattern such high skills not everyone could do, but some cloud patterns could be managed.

Across the world, not only Chen Country, and it’s not just Jiangzhou, the State City is so big.

Many noble families, many high officials.

Those gentlemen, wearing red robes, purple robes, not just the Right Minister.

Their matters were not surprising, a thousand miles away Yue Pengwu, could not affect the elegant interests of ladies and young women watching flowers in the snow, nor did anyone care about the embroiderers.

In the glaring light of the oil lamps, many embroidered similar things, they did not recognize the words, only simply followed ’pictures’ to embroider, amidst the cloud patterns, like rosy flags.

It said — Joyfully welcoming the Royal Army.

In this cramped, narrow room, dazzling, like fire.

The watchman walked by, knocking on the wooden clappers, shouting:

"Beware of fire, watch out for candles!"

The wind and snow are strong, flowers crushed.

Beauties like jade, scholars elegant.

Another peaceful day it is.
